The renewal of our three-year agreement with Torvane Materials has been assessed in detail. Proposed terms include a 4.2% unit-price increase, partially offset by improved volume rebates and extended payment terms of sixty days. Sensitivity analysis indicates a net annual cost impact of under 1% on the Meridia product line, assuming stable demand. Legal has flagged no material changes to liability clauses. We recommend approval, subject to the conditions outlined in the confidential note below.

confidential, yawip-bahif: Zorokox Partners plans to lower the Casax list price by 28.0 percent in April. The board signed off on a budget of $271.0 million for Project Juldor. The renewal with Pelokox Partners closes at $410.1 million a year, 3.4 percent below the last contract. Project Pelok slips by a full year because of the audit delay.

Environments for Sketchloom's undo/redo service: dev runs on the Pinrow cluster with an unbounded history stack, staging caps it at 200 steps, and prod at 500 with snapshot compaction. Release managers: promote only after the redo-replay suite passes in staging, since compaction bugs love to hide there. The prod environment's current settings are listed below.

service settings:
[quenath]
host = quenath.zemvarcorp.corp
user = quenath_svc
database = quenath_prod

Account Recovery — Quillbase Report Builder

Context: sorting in Quillbase reports must stay stable; the admin account controls the tiebreak config. If that account locks, stable-sort settings cannot be edited and nightly reports may reorder rows nondeterministically. Do not touch the sort index tables. Instead, open the recovery tool on the ops bastion, pick the reports-admin identity, and start passphrase recovery. Verify the lock reason in the audit log first. Then supply the recovery passphrase shown directly below.

vault phrase of tawig-taduf = zorath-oliwyn

Subject: Reset-flow cut-over done

Team — the Lockhaven password reset revamp went live last night. Old token links stayed valid through the overlap window; zero support tickets so far. Rate limiting moved to the edge tier, and the mailer now uses the new template set. Rollback path is documented in the runbook. Production is currently running with the following configuration values.

service settings:
[casax]
port = 6379
team = rusir
host = casax.zemvarhq.corp
region = outer-4
access_code = ac_9808ce
timeout_ms = 1500